I agree on the Pimsleur - it has been the best one for forcing me to open my mouth and answer the danged recording.

The Norwords website provides free audio for their textbooks Sett i Gang I and Sett I Gang II and I really like it. I made CDs and just put them on repeat in the car. It is not the question and respond format, but I like the lists, the conversations, just hearing the overall sounds repeated...
I would purchase the texts, except they are crazy expensive used on Amazon.

Teach Yourself Norwegian Conversation is another one like Pimsleur that asks you to talk back, but it may be too simple for you.

(There are three CDs and the level by the last lesson is not very complex: The speakers are saying goodbye at an airport shuttle: "Yes. Yes, it is the airport bus. Here is your rucksack. Do you have your aeroplane ticket? Yes, I have everything. I shall miss you. It isn't long until September.")

I don't love it, but it is not terrible. It makes me impatient for two trivial reasons: A.) There is a perky musical phrase that repeats at the beginning of each lesson and it drives me batty. And B.) the speakers speak slowwwly, and it feels unnatural. But if it helps to get you talking, then so what, right?
